Jan 19 @ 9:00 am - 11:00 am Drive Thru Pet Pantry SPCA of Texas' Dallas Animal Care Center 2400 Lone Star Dr., Dallas Join the SPCA of Texas on January 19th from 9AM-11AM at the SPCA of Texas’ Dallas Animal Care Center, 2400 Lone Star Drive, Dallas, TX 75212 for our January Drive Thru Pet Food Pantry! Registration is required. The SPCA of...